Propriété Style borderColor

Définition et utilisation

borderColor Cette propriété configure ou retourne la couleur de la bordure de l'élément.

Cette propriété peut accepter une à quatre valeurs :

  • Une valeur, par exemple : p {border-color: red} - tous les quatre bords sont rouges
  • Deux valeurs, par exemple : p {border-color: red transparent} - Les bordures supérieure et inférieure sont rouges, les bordures latérales sont transparentes
  • Trois valeurs, par exemple : p {border-color: red green blue}- La bordure supérieure est rouge, les bordures latérales sont vertes, la bordure inférieure est bleue
  • Quatre valeurs, par exemple : p {border-color: red green blue yellow} - La bordure supérieure est rouge, la bordure droite est verte, la bordure inférieure est bleue, la bordure gauche est jaune

Voir également :

Tutoriel CSS :Bordure CSS

Manuel de référence CSS :Propriété border-color

Manuel de référence HTML DOM :Propriété border

Exemple

Exemple 1

Changez la couleur de la bordure des quatre côtés de l'élément <div> en rouge :

document.getElementById("myDiv").style.borderColor = "red";

Essayez-le vous-même

Exemple 2

Changez la couleur de la bordure supérieure et inférieure de l'élément <div> en vert, et la couleur de la bordure latérale en pourpre :

document.getElementById("myDiv").style.borderColor = "green purple";

Essayez-le vous-même

Exemple 3

Retourne la couleur de bordure de l'élément <div> :

alert(document.getElementById("myDiv").style.borderColor);

Essayez-le vous-même

Syntaxe

Retourne la propriété borderColor :

object.style.borderColor

Définir la propriété borderColor :

object.style.borderColor = "color|transparent|initial|inherit"

Valeur de l'attribut

Valeur Description
color

Définit la couleur de la bordure. La couleur par défaut est noire.

Voir Valeur de couleur CSS, pour obtenir la liste complète des valeurs de couleur possibles.

transparent La couleur de la bordure est transparente (le contenu sous-jacent est visible).
initial Définit cette propriété à sa valeur par défaut. Voir initial.
inherit Inherits this property from its parent element. Voir inherit.

Détails techniques

Valeur par défaut : noir
Valeur de retour : Chaîne, représentant la couleur de la bordure de l'élément.
Version de CSS : CSS1

Prise en charge du navigateur

Les nombres dans le tableau indiquent la version du navigateur qui prend en charge cette propriété pour la première fois.

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
1.0 4.0 1.0 1.0 3.5